West Brom’s Steven Reid labels Zoltan Gera’s latest injury as ‘devastating’

London - Arabstoday
After making the switch back to the Hawthorns on a free transfer this summer, Gera has only managed to make three league appearances for the club due to injuries earlier in the season. Even though the player hasn’t been involved in all of the games this term, team-mate Reid feels that this absence will be ‘devastating’ as the side approach the busy winter period. Reid told the Express & Star: “I am devastated for Zolly as a player and as a team-mate. “It’s a blow to the team but first and foremost your thoughts go out to him, we just hope his rehab goes well and he’s back as soon as possible.” After suffering long term injuries himself, Reid sympathised with Gera on his misfortune with injuries since making his switch. “I’ve been in similar situations, where I’ve had long-term injuries, come back for a spell, and then been out with another problem,” he stated.  “If there is anything I can do to help him in his rehab then I will do. He’s a great lad.”
